Beadhead nymph hooks have become indispensable for serious fly fishers across British waters, combining carefully engineered hook geometry with strategically positioned tungsten or glass beads to achieve rapid, controlled descent through challenging river conditions. Unlike standard fly hooks, these purpose-built designs feature integrated beads that add significant mass whilst maintaining a compact profile, allowing anglers to reach the bottom feeding zones where trout and grayling spend most of their time. The beaded construction delivers multiple practical advantages: improved sink rates through fast-flowing sections, enhanced hook-setting mechanics thanks to the weight distribution, and superior posture retention that mimics natural nymph behaviour in current. British anglers pursuing selective trout on chalk streams favour smaller beadhead patterns, whilst those targeting deep pools and winter grayling on northern rivers benefit from heavier tungsten configurations. The choice between tungsten—prized for its density and minimal profile—and glass—valued for its visibility, colour range, and cost-effectiveness—fundamentally shapes your tactical approach. Modern UK fly tyers increasingly select jig-style beadheads for their superior hook-up rates and versatility across varying water depths and speeds.

Understanding Beadhead Hook Performance & Selection

Beadhead effectiveness relies on several interconnected factors. Tungsten beads, approximately 40% denser than brass alternatives, compress weight into minimal volume—critical for maintaining natural profile in selective conditions. Glass beads offer superior visibility for pattern recognition and experimentation, plus broader colour palettes for seasonal and water-condition matching. Jig-style hooks—characterised by a 60-degree bend creating a horizontal presentation angle—demonstrate consistently superior hook-ups compared to traditional curved designs, particularly in faster flows where orientation matters significantly. Hook size selection directly influences casting ease and trout behaviour: sizes 18-16 suit spring and early-summer chalk streams with pressured fish, whilst sizes 14-12 dominate autumn and winter tactics on mainstream rivers. Bead positioning at the hook eye creates aggressive sink profiles, whilst offset positioning just behind the eye maintains slightly improved fly posture in gentle currents.
